Output 875c332094baf8d14d903209fe5288f143dbc27d1c2d05255688c60201e41664:0

value
18599115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af2239e013579871a0d0423b1f3376ac95089f52 OP_EQUAL
address
3Hf3BBbVfqs1cpUGYU8rauMSy1xEvgj5yU
transaction
875c332094baf8d14d903209fe5288f143dbc27d1c2d05255688c60201e41664
spent
true